The Executive – Accounts and Finance will be responsible for managing project-wise inventory accounting, preparing journal vouchers, and ensuring accurate entry of financial data based on system records. The role also includes VAT and tax documentation, reconciliation of ledgers, and support for audits. This position requires attention to detail, working knowledge of accounting systems, and the ability to coordinate across departments to maintain compliance and reporting accuracy.Job Description / Responsibilities
Job NatureInventory Management
- Enter project-wise Material Requisition Reports (MRR), Material Transfer Notes (MTN), and consumption data in ERP.
- Prepare and post related Journal Vouchers (JVs) in Tally.
- Reconcile and fix MRR, Store Issue Notes (SIN), and MTN entries.
Accounting Entries
- Record Journal Vouchers in the system for contractor/supplier bills, advance adjustments, salary provisions, and bank interest.
- Prepare and record intercompany Journals.
- Ensure timely and accurate entry of other journals as and when required.
VAT & Tax Compliance
- Prepare Mushak forms: 6.2.1, 6.3, and 6.6; send these to relevant parties as required.
- Reconcile tax ledgers with the general ledger.
- Prepare VAT/Tax challans and maintain proper documentation for audits and inspections.
